Как установить аргументы JVM в IntelliJ?

Я запутался в инструкции при использовании Kinesis Video Stream

Запустите DemoAppMain.java в./src/main/demo с аргументами JVM, установленными в

-Daws.accessKeyId={YourAwsAccessKey} -Daws.secretKey={YourAwsSecretKey} -Djava.library.path={NativeLibraryPath} 

для невременных учетных данных AWS.

Как установить эти аргументы в IntelliJ? Я проследил за документацией и нашел "Run/Debug Configurations" и не знаю, что делать дальше. Любая помощь? Спасибо!

6 ответов

Решение

Вы правы насчет Run/Debug Configurations раздел!

Все, что вам нужно сделать, это добавить свои аргументы VM options или же Program argumentsв зависимости от типа аргументов, которые вы пытаетесь передать.

Если у вас установлена ​​версия сообщества 2021.1.1, выполните следующие действия:

Перейти к редактированию конфигурации и поставить

-Dserver.port=9006(required port no) 

в параметрах виртуальной машины: и применить и запустить, он будет работать

Вы можете добавить несколько аргументов виртуальной машины

      -Dserver.port=8999 -Dapi.prediction.base.url=https://ags-qa-predictions.azur -Dlogging.level.org.springframework.data.mongodb.core.MongoTemplate=DEBUG -Dspring.jpa.show-sql=true -Dspring.profiles.active=prod

Вы можете установить его в Intellij, используя

Help -> Edit Custom Vm Options

-еа

-Dlogging.level. {Classname} = DEBUG

Другие вопросы по тегам